ASP.NET MVC 4 в действии

ASP.NET MVC 4 в действии

Джеффри Палермо

Резюме

ASP.NET MVC на данный момент включает множество возможностей организации контента в представлениях. Дочерние действия могут разделять запросы на дискретные отдельные элементы, а шаблоны позволяют вам создавать стандартизированный контент в ваших представлениях. При использовании мастер-страниц, частичных представлений, дочерних действий, шаблонов и вспомогательных расширений HTML вы получаете множество вариантов отображения ваших представлений помимо всего лишь единичной страницы. Каждый из этих вариантов имеет свои положительные стороны, и вы можете быть уверены, что к любому дублированию, которое вы встретите в ваших представлениях, можно обратиться. Единственный вопрос – каким образом вы хотите обратиться к нему. Использование построителя параметра строки запроса – один из этих вариантов.

Благодаря расширяемости ASP.NET MVC вы можете также выгружать ваш движок представления из оперативной памяти без воздействия на ваши контроллеры. Движок представления Spark, оптимизированный для кода в разметке, – конкурентная альтернатива некоторому безобразию, которое появляется при смешивании C# и разметки в традиционном движке представления Web Forms.

В следующей главе мы рассмотрим расширенное MVC представление с инъекцией зависимостей.

или RSS канал: Что новенького на smarly.net